How has technology continued advancing to help with cyber threats

As technology has advanced, so too have the methods used by cybercriminals, which has made protecting personal and business data extra challenging. In response, cybersecurity innovation has advanced rapidly, guarding both individuals at home and sensitive information across various industries

New tools and techniques are constantly being developed to keep up with evolving threats. With each technological breakthrough, we’re seeing more sophisticated systems that can handle cyber threats, helping you keep your details safe.  

Artificial Intelligence (AI)  

AI has transformed cybersecurity by enabling systems to detect and respond to risks in real time. Unlike traditional security methods, which rely on predefined rules, it can identify unusual activity and even act autonomously.  

By learning from large datasets, AI continuously improves its ability to spot suspicious activity, making it essential in the fight against evolving cybercrime. Its speed also reduces response times, facilitating faster action and minimizing damage during an attack. 

The rise of encryption and secure communication 

Encryption has become a vital tool for securing sensitive information. It converts data into a scrambled format that can only be read with the correct decryption key, preventing cybercriminals from intercepting it.  

End-to-end encryption takes this further so that even service providers cannot access the content of your messages. This guarantees full privacy. Many messaging apps now use end-to-end encryption to protect your conversations. Whether for financial transactions or confidential emails, this method safeguards your details from the moment they leave your device, making it much harder for hackers to intercept and exploit. 

The role of password managers in protecting accounts 

With more online accounts than ever, managing complex passwords has become increasingly difficult. Weak or reused combinations are major contributors to technology breaches.  

password manager helps users create and store complex passwords securely, reducing vulnerabilities caused by weak alternatives. This way, you can shield yourself from one of the most common online security vulnerabilities. Many come with added features like strength analysis and breach alerts for added peace of mind.  

Multi-factor authentication for extra security 

Multi-factor authentication (MFA) is now a standard for securing personal and business accounts. It requires more than just one form of account identification—typically combining something you know (like a password), something you have (like a mobile phone), and sometimes something you are (like biometric data).  

This added barrier means that even if a hacker steals your password, they can’t see your account without the second or third factor. With phishing attacks and data theft on the rise, MFA provides a crucial barrier to unauthorized access. Enabling MFA, whether through SMS codes, authentication apps, or fingerprint recognition, significantly reduces the risk of compromise.
